1. Digital Marketing Skills

Digital marketing remains one of the best tech skills in Nigeria because every business wants visibility online.

Brands need people who understand how to attract customers using social media, Google, email marketing, advertising, and content creation.

Digital marketing skills include:

• Social media marketing

• Facebook and Instagram ads

• Search engine optimization (SEO)

• Content marketing

• Email marketing

• Google Ads

• Influencer marketing

Businesses in Nigeria are spending more money online than ever before. Someone who understands digital marketing can work with companies, run campaigns for clients, or even build a personal brand.

This is one of the top skills that pay in Nigeria because businesses constantly need customers and online visibility.

2. Data Analysis Skills

Data analysis is becoming one of the most valuable digital skills in Nigeria.

Companies now use data to make decisions. Banks, telecom companies, hospitals, schools, and startups all need professionals who can interpret data and generate insights.

Data analysts work with tools like:

• Microsoft Excel

• SQL

• Power BI

• Tableau

• Python

Data analysis training in Abuja is becoming highly popular among graduates and working professionals because it opens doors to both local and international job opportunities.

If you enjoy solving problems and working with numbers, data analysis can become a strong career path.

3. Website Design Skills

Every serious business today needs a website.

From restaurants and real estate companies to schools and fashion brands, websites are now essential for credibility and sales.

Website design skills include:

• WordPress development

• Front end web design

• Responsive website creation

• UI and UX basics

• E commerce website setup

Website designers in Nigeria earn from freelance jobs, company projects, and long term maintenance contracts.

This remains one of the best digital skills to learn in Nigeria because the demand continues to grow every year.

5. Cybersecurity and Ethical Hacking

Cybercrime is increasing globally, and companies are becoming more serious about protecting their systems and customer data.

Cybersecurity professionals help organizations secure their networks, applications, and digital infrastructure.

This field includes:

• Ethical hacking

• Network security

• Penetration testing

• Security operations

• Threat analysis

Cybersecurity is one of the highest paying tech fields worldwide, and the demand in Nigeria is also rising rapidly.

7. Video Editing and Content Creation

Short videos are dominating social media platforms.

Content creators, influencers, churches, businesses, and organizations all need quality video editors.

Video editing is one of the skills that pay in Nigeria because brands are competing heavily for online attention.

Popular tools include:

• Adobe Premiere Pro

• CapCut

• After Effects

• Canva

• DaVinci Resolve

Content creation is also becoming a full time career for many Nigerians.

How to Choose the Right Digital Skill

A lot of people ask this question.

The truth is, the “best” skill depends on your goals.

If you enjoy creativity, graphic design or video editing may fit you.

If you enjoy problem solving, data analysis or cybersecurity may work better.

If you like business and communication, digital marketing could be ideal.

The important thing is to start somewhere and stay consistent.

Many successful people in tech today started with little or no experience.
